写点什么

Scrum 看板:是进展,还是矛盾?

  • 2009-11-21
  • 本文字数:1299 字

    阅读完需:约 4 分钟

尽管看板不是什么新鲜事物,但有越来越多的敏捷软件开发方法的使用者开始关注它。相关讲话、研习班、甚至一整个与之相关的会议都如雨后春笋一般不断涌现,敏捷的培训师们也把看板加入了自己的讲授课程之中。有实用精神的敏捷专家们开始研究这种来自精益的方法能为团队带来哪些好处,引人之处包括:揭示瓶颈、更快取得更多进度、让团队体验更多的“流畅”状态而变得更为快乐。在这个大环境中,Simon Bennett 的一篇看板思想是Scrum 的氪星石》给希望将看板结合到Scrum 流程的人敲响了一记警钟。看板的提倡者们同意Bennet 的看法,认为看板对于障碍的处理方法不那么积极,这与Scrum 要求立即移除障碍的理念有所冲突。

Bennett 在博客文章中声明,他自己既不是一个反对看板的呛声者,也不是发表类似“要保持 Scrum 纯洁性”长篇大论的人。他指出:

如果你打算试用 Scrum,但是忽略或隐藏障碍(甚至根本不在第一时间说出它们),那你就等于是自找苦吃,而且不会取得工作进展。这就是 Ken Schwaber Martin Fowler 提到过的“松弛的 Scrum”(至少从技术债的角度看是这样)。 Scrum 和看板都奖励透明度,不过是以不同的方式:Scrum 内建了对于行动的直接召唤,必须要应答这种召唤,Scrum 才能成功。

看板允许你和团队只是“接受”障碍,还要衡量它们的影响。

他认为:两者背后的思想是冲突的,“当看板思想迫近时,Scrum 项目就会一直得到削弱”。然而,应用纯粹的思想并不是目标,目标是高质量的软件和频繁的交付。为了达成目标,他鼓励实践者们检查他们从事什么样的项目,使用 Scrum 的成功率如何,他还提供了指南,帮人们选择使用合适的方法论。

Corey Ladas2008 年的文章“ Scrum 看板”讲述了向看板演进的过程,如果走得足够远的话,看板就能替换绝大多数的 Scrum。Ladas 的方法会修改甚至替代许多传统的 Scrum 实践,比如每日立会和燃尽图。有趣的是,在 Agile2007 大会上凭借自己的看板实施经验报告让人们眼前一亮的 Anderson(看来他目前主要的经历放在实施看板上)提到,他最初的意图不是为了“让人们转而离开 Scrum”,而是要帮助实施敏捷有困难的人。Bennett 的博客指出:团队在引入看板之前要想清楚,团队自身从 Scrum 中获得足够价值了么?他补充道:“如果你真的在开发最前沿的技术,那我想你将来还会依赖 Scrum。”

虽然 Bennett 并未被列入 Limited WIP Society (该社区希望成为软件开发社区的看板之家)的思想领导者之列,很多被列席的人都在他的博客留言中表示了支持之意,其中包括 Karl Scotland 和 David J. Anderson。Anderson 表示赞同:

是的,看板是一种进化,而 Scrum 是一种革命。我非常同意这种定位。

当然,任何工具都可能被误用。Chris Sims 的文章《 Are Kanban Workflows Agile? 》提醒读者:如果看板被用来确保每项必要活动都发生了,那就等于是用作强制推行团队对完成的定义,这活有个检查列表就可以了。同时Mitch Lacey 最近总听到这样的话在提醒人们:“说到底,没有什么万能钥匙。说一个什么东西比其他东西更能解决人们的问题,那不过是一厢情愿、痴人说梦而已。”

在InfoQ 上还有更多与看板相关的内容:文章演讲

查看英文原文: ScrumBan - Evolution or Oxymoron?

2009-11-21 12:042121
用户头像

发布了 479 篇内容, 共 161.5 次阅读, 收获喜欢 52 次。

关注

评论

发布
暂无评论
发现更多内容

CloudBees CI使用Velero进行灾备(DR)概念验证

龙智—DevSecOps解决方案

ci 停机时间 灾难恢复计划

跟着官方文档学 Python 之:基础语法

甜甜的白桃

Python 数据类型 7月月更

全面掌控!打造智慧城市建设的"领导驾驶舱"

华为云开发者联盟

云计算 后端 智慧城市 智慧屏

都有哪些较好用的项目管理软件?

爱吃小舅的鱼

项目管理 项目管理软件

关于FAQ页面的一些制作技巧

Baklib

基础设施 NFTScan 正式发布 Solana 网络 NFT 浏览器

NFT Research

区块链 NFT

卷是真的卷,“粗心马虎”也是真的要扣分

图灵教育

数学 小学 初中

HTTP的前世今生

技术小生

HTTP 7月月更

Klocwork部署的安全最佳实践

龙智—DevSecOps解决方案

klocwork 静态代码分析 SAST工具

万字多图,搞懂 Nginx 高性能网络工作原理!

C++后台开发

nginx 中间件 后端开发 高性能网络 C++开发

DevOps工具链:开放、自由地选择最适合团队和业务需要的工具

龙智—DevSecOps解决方案

DevOps DevOps工具 DevOps工具链

React + Node.js 全栈实战教程 - 手把手教你搭建「文件上传」管理后台

蒋川

node.js react.js mongodb Express axios

带你认识数仓的“规格变更”

华为云开发者联盟

数据库 后端 集群 数仓

【C 语言】进阶指针 Five

謓泽

7月月更

体验SRCNN和FSRCNN两种图像超分网络应用

华为云开发者联盟

人工智能 图像 图像超分

影响分析:RubyGems未授权访问漏洞(CVE-2022-29176)

龙智—DevSecOps解决方案

rubygems 漏洞

干货|语义网、Web3.0、Web3、元宇宙这些概念还傻傻分不清楚?(上)

Orillusion

开源 WebGL 元宇宙 Metaverse webgpu

IPA应用探索:基于客户意图交互让业务受理更有“温度”

鲸品堂

运营商

知乎基于 Apache Doris 的 DMP 平台架构建设实践|万字长文详解

SelectDB

Apache 数据库 数据仓库 广告系统 Doris

企业知识管理过程中常见的误区与解决方法

Baklib

Hive表类型

五分钟学大数据

hive 7月月更

Spring Security用户定义

急需上岸的小谢

7月月更

一个月后,我们又从 MySQL 双主切换成了主 - 从!

悟空聊架构

MySQL 悟空聊架构 征文活动 7月月更

P4Python:合并实践指南之如何脚本化integrate流程

龙智—DevSecOps解决方案

文件合并 P4 Perforce Helix Core

AIRIOT物联网平台助力油库自动化升级 实现业务场景全覆盖

AIRIOT

低代码 物联网 低代码,项目开发

InfoQ专访 | 联邦学习将会带来数据价值挖掘的下一个爆发点

Jessica@数牍

联邦学习

LeaRun快速开发平台:企业供应链管理系统解决方案

力软低代码开发平台

一、What's API

忠厚

API API Explorer平台 api 网关

从工程师到技术leader的思维升级

阿里技术

技术成长

华为云GaussDB两大数据库通过中国信通院多项评测

华为云开发者联盟

数据库 后端 华为云

数据仓库与大数据挖掘技术调度平台- TASKCTL

敏捷调度TASKCTL

数据仓库 国产开源 TASKCTL 大数据仓库 DevOps工具

Scrum看板:是进展,还是矛盾?_研发效能_Deborah Hartmann Preuss_InfoQ精选文章